While the total number of active cases in Punjab has crossed 2000-mark, Jalandhar reported 32 new cases of coronavirus on Thursday. According to the information, the new cases include Shahkot SDM Sanjeev Kumar and a Deputy Superintendent of Police (DSP) of Punjab Police. Earlier, a 54-year-old man died due to coronavirus pandemic. He was a resident of Sultanpur Lodhi. He was admitted to the civil hospital in Jalandhar. On Wednesday, Mohali SDM was tested positive for coronavirus. Mohali reported 6 new cases of coronavirus on Thursday taking the total number of cases in the district to 337. The coronavirus cases in Punjab have been rising ever since the government started announcing relaxations in the restrictions imposed during the lockdown.
